Paris award for Hamad hailed

FUJAIRAH - The Arab Institute in Paris has awarded the Gold Medal to His Highness Shaikh Hamad bin Mohammed Al Sharqi, Member of the Supreme Council and Ruler of Fujairah, for the effective role he played in supporting culture and intellectual communication between the Arab world and Europe. Speaking on the occasion, the Director of the Arab Institute, Mukhtar Talib bin Deyab, lauded the effective role of the UAE under the leadership of the President, His Highness Shaikh Khalifa bin Zayed Al Nahyan, and Shaik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Vice-President and Prime Minister of the UAE and Ruler of Dubai, in preserving national heritage and developing innovation and culture communications. Nasir Al Yamahi, Chairman of Fujairah Club and head of Fujairah Media Office, congratulated Shaikh Hamad and pointed out that the medal is a clear reflection of his great role in the field of cultural. The Deputy Director of Fujairah Municipality, Mohammed Saif Al Afkham, said the awarding of the Gold Medal to Shaikh Hamad highlights the great support he offers for cultural development. Khalid Al Mazroee, Director of Fujairah Airport, said the honouring of Shaikh Hamad is a pride for all citizens, and it reflects the cultural and intellectual depth of His Highness.
